Scansano and Morellino

Scansano, a village of medieval origin perched on the hills of the Grosseto Maremma, in Tuscany, owes its international fame to Morellino, the local name for the Sangiovese grape variety. The bond between the town and its wine is so deep that it gives its name to this motorcycle rally, which celebrates both the passion for motorcycling and the pride of a territory with a strong and recognizable identity.

Practical information — Motomorellino

How to get there

Scansano can be reached by car or motorcycle via the SS322 delle Collacchie and the provincial roads of the Maremma. The nearest motorway exit is on the Aurelia (SS1) near Grosseto, from where you continue towards the hinterland. The reference railway station is Grosseto, about 30 km away.
